In relation to the new dues and assessments that have been handed down by the International Office, it has caused the Intake fee in the Atlantic Coast Region to increase. Because of this increase we will no longer charge a $50 fee for crossing paraphernalia. We will leave that optional and the individual chapter can decide if they choose to participate in the ordering process. all you will have to do is notify your State Director of your decision. However there will still be a Regional Intake fee of $50 and Regional Chapter dues will still be due. All chapters who will be
participating in Spring Intake must have ALL money and paperwork in one week before the process is scheduled to begin. No lines will start until you are given clearance. In the event that this happens the intake process will be discontinued until further notice. Any chapter found to be in violation of either of these regulations will face penalties on a Regional and National level.

The new structure is as follows:

REGIONAL INTAKE FEE
$512.50
$275-Application Fee
$100-Make the new brother financial for 1st year
$87.50-National Assessment Fee(Includes $55 50th Anniversary fee and $32.50 Centaur Magazine subscription)
$50-Regional Intake Fee

REGIONAL DUES STRUCTURE


UNDERGRADUATE CHAPTER- $30
GRADUATE CHAPTER- $50


REGIONAL DUES WINDOW WILL OPEN UP FROM FEB. 1ST-MAR. 1ST, 2010
